7 cops detained for slay attempt on Espinosa

The Philippine National Police (PNP) is currently holding seven of its personnel on suspicion of involvement in the botched assassination attempt on Albuera, Leyte mayoral candidate Rolan Eslabon “Kerwin” Espinosa.

“We now have seven policemen under custody… they are being investigated on whether or not they have anything to do with the shooting of Mr. Espinosa,” PNP spokesperson Brigadier General Jean Fajardo told reporters in Filipino on Friday.

They were later identified as Colonel Reydante Ariza, Lieutenant Colonel Leonides Sydiongco, Sergeant Alrose Astilla, Corporal Arvin Jose Baronda, Corporal Jeffrey Dagoy, Corporal Alexander Reponte, and Patrolman Maricor Espinosa.

She explained that the seven cops were caught inside a compound where the getaway vehicle of the suspected shooter tried to hide following a hot pursuit operation.

A cache of firearms was also discovered in two vehicles parked inside the compound.

“We [PNP] conducted a pursuit operation because we had a motor vehicle of interest, a Montero, which allegedly fled the scene of the shooting in a hurry,” Fajardo added.

“We managed to catch up with it immediately. Upon entering the compound [where the alleged getaway vehicle entered], we came upon the seven cops there,” she added.

The seven detained PNP personnel were assigned to the Ormoc City Police Station.

Following the incident, images were released online showing Espinosa wounded but apparently out of danger.

However, rumors were rife that the mayoralty candidate staged the assassination attempt to drum up public support for his campaign.

“Who would deliberately aim to get shot near their heart? This was not a staged event,” Espinosa said in a live-stream post on Facebook.

“This happened because they do not want me to serve as mayor of Albuera because their businesses would be affected,” he added without identifying suspects.

Last October, Espinosa testified before the House of Representatives that former PNP chief and now Senator Ronald “Bato” Dela Rosa forced him to implicate former Sen. Leila De Lima and businessman Peter Lim in the illegal drug trade.

He said that the former police chief threatened to harm him and his family if he refused to comply with the order.

Dela Rosa previously served as the Duterte administration’s first PNP chief and is also known as the implementer of its bloody drug war.

Espinosa’s father, Rolando Sr., then Albuera mayor, was killed in a supposed shootout with lawmen in November 2016 while detained at the Baybay City Provincial Jail on drug charges.

Nineteen policemen were charged for the killing but were acquitted by a Quezon City court. They were later on reinstated in the service by former President Rodrigo Duterte.
